首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python 2.7 fnmatch不编辑文本

Python 2.7中的fnmatch模块是用于文件名匹配的工具。它提供了一种简单的方法来比较文件名与通配符模式,以确定它们是否匹配。

fnmatch模块中最常用的函数是fnmatch()和fnmatchcase()。这两个函数都接受一个文件名和一个通配符模式作为参数,并返回一个布尔值来指示是否匹配。

fnmatch()函数使用操作系统的大小写规则来匹配文件名和模式,而fnmatchcase()函数则区分大小写。这两个函数都支持常见的通配符模式,如"*"匹配任意字符序列,"?"匹配任意单个字符,"[]"用于指定字符集合等。

fnmatch模块的优势在于它提供了一种简单而灵活的方法来进行文件名匹配,特别适用于需要根据特定模式来筛选文件的场景。它可以用于文件搜索、文件过滤、文件名匹配等各种应用。

以下是一些fnmatch模块的应用场景:

  1. 文件搜索和过滤:可以使用fnmatch模块来搜索特定模式的文件,或者过滤出符合特定模式的文件列表。
  2. 批量处理文件:可以使用fnmatch模块来批量处理符合特定模式的文件,例如重命名、复制、移动等操作。
  3. 文件备份和同步:可以使用fnmatch模块来匹配需要备份或同步的文件,以便进行相应的操作。
  4. 文件管理工具:可以使用fnmatch模块来开发文件管理工具,例如文件浏览器、文件对比工具等。

腾讯云提供了丰富的云计算产品,其中与文件处理相关的产品是对象存储(COS)。对象存储是一种高可靠、低成本的云存储服务,适用于存储和处理各种类型的文件。您可以使用腾讯云对象存储来存储、管理和访问您的文件,并通过API进行文件的上传、下载、复制等操作。

腾讯云对象存储产品介绍链接地址:https://cloud.tencent.com/product/cos

请注意,本回答中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券